S1 0-238 Sentence denotes The activity of the CCAAT-box binding factor NF-Y is modulated through the regulated expression of its A subunit during monocyte to macrophage differentiation: regulation of tissue-specific genes through a ubiquitous transcription factor.
S2 239-347 Sentence denotes In this study, we analyzed the regulation of NF-Y expression during human monocyte to macrophage maturation.
S3 348-523 Sentence denotes NF-Y is a ubiquitous and evolutionarily conserved transcription factor that binds specifically to the CCAAT motif present in the 5' promoter region of a wide variety of genes.
S4 524-871 Sentence denotes We show here that in circulating monocytes, NF-Y binding activity is not detected on the CCAAT motif present in the promoters of genes such as major histocompatibility complex (MHC) class II, gp91-phox, mig, and fibronectin, whereas during macrophage differentiation, a progressive increase in NF-Y binding activity is observed on these promoters.
S5 872-1014 Sentence denotes Analysis of NF-Y subunit expression indicates that the absence of NF-Y activity in circulating monocytes is caused by a lack of the A subunit.
S6 1015-1092 Sentence denotes Furthermore, addition of the recombinant NF-YA subunit restores NF-Y binding.
S7 1093-1216 Sentence denotes We show that the lack of NF-YA protein is due to posttranscriptional regulation and not to a specific proteolytic activity.
S8 1217-1426 Sentence denotes In fact, NF-YA mRNA is present at the same level at all days of monocyte cultivation, whereas the protein is absent in freshly isolated monocytes but is progressively synthesized during the maturation process.
S9 1427-1563 Sentence denotes We thus conclude that the NF-YA subunit plays a relevant role in activating transcription of genes highly expressed in mature monocytes.
S10 1564-1764 Sentence denotes In line with this conclusion, we show that the cut/CDP protein, a transcriptional repressor that inhibits gpc91-phox gene expression by preventing NF-Y binding to the CAAT box, is absent in monocytes.
